Diary entry of Gina Ekdal:
Dear diary,
Today started out as a particularly uneventful day. I was looking after Hedvig and while sewing and relaxing. Then comes in Old Ekdal, with even more copying work in his hands. At least he's making his own pocket money, which makes his living with us more pleasant. I feel very worried about Grandpa Ekdal, his usual crankiness and his old age do not go well together.
Soon after Old Ekdal retired to his office, Hjalmar came back. Seems that his dinner party went well with the exception of that nuisance Gregers. That man even came to our home later that evening. How dare he question the years of marraige that my husband and I have shared! I wondered what Gregers ulterior motives were when he sat down with my husband.
The Ekdal men are so fascinated by a lame animal. This wild duck that Old Ekdal shot is just an ordinary animal, made even worse by the fact that Old Werle was involved in putting the duck into our home. Coincidentally, another animal has been brought into our house, Gregers. He even claims to want to be a dog chasing after silly ducks again.
I believe that the Werle family is just plain trouble and that the things that are happening between the father and son will be sorted out in a different place than our home.
